PURPOSE:To attain a film thickness and a pattern width of a part, which should be the magnetic pole tip part of an upper magnetic layer, with a high precision by forming the part, which should be the magnetic pole tip part, and the other parts of the upper magnetic layer, which constitutes a U-shaped magnetic pole, independently of each other by adhesion. CONSTITUTION:A lower magnetic layer 12 and a gap layer 13 are formed into prescribed patterns on a nonmagnetic substrate 11 by the plating method or the like. The first upper magnetic layer 14a consisting of ''Permalloy '' or the like is patterned into a prescribed shape with a prescribed thickness in the region, where a gap part should be constituted, on the gap layer 13. An insulating layer 15, a coil conductor layer 16, and an insulating layer 17 are formed in the other regions on the gap layer 13 in order by lamination. Insulating layers 15 and 17 are patterned simultaneously. After the second upper magnetic layer 14b consisting of ''Permalloy '' is adhered onto the insulating layer 17 and a part of the first upper magnetic layer 14a on the substrate 11, which is constituted in this manner, by sputtering or the like, the substrate 11 is patterned into a prescribed shape by the photolithographic method or the like. |
